Massachusetts 2004 Presidential Election

John Kerry vs. George W. Bush

John Kerry won the Massachusetts 2004 presidential election with 1,803,800 votes (61.9%), a margin of D+25.2. Massachusetts's 11 electoral votes went to the Democratic ticket.
